Output 3e442eeaac0ed3d6981de382a803087d1ab5ebb1bc112be4553b3547efcc2bf5:21

value
130627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a2e4c3eda0fdc04ae5dc858595773a9a75a4a9 OP_EQUAL
address
39xFsrZL6HdUbb7QrK2Q1VexMqD5bzimKF
transaction
3e442eeaac0ed3d6981de382a803087d1ab5ebb1bc112be4553b3547efcc2bf5
confirmations
249390
spent
true